OLD | NEW |
1 Tests asynchronous call stacks for async functions. | 1 Tests asynchronous call stacks for async functions. |
2 | 2 |
3 Set timer for test function. | 3 Set timer for test function. |
4 Captured call stacks in no particular order: | 4 Captured call stacks in no particular order: |
5 Call stack: | 5 Call stack: |
6 0) doTestChainedPromises (async-callstack-async-await2.html:67) | 6 0) doTestChainedPromises (async-callstack-async-await2.html:67) |
7 [Promise.resolve] | 7 [async function] |
8 0) resolvePromise (async-callstack-async-await2.html:12) | 8 0) doTestChainedPromises (async-callstack-async-await2.html:63) |
9 [setTimeout] | 9 1) testFunctionTimeout (async-callstack-async-await2.html:50) |
10 0) promiseCallback (async-callstack-async-await2.html:21) | |
11 1) timeoutPromise (async-callstack-async-await2.html:9) | |
12 2) doTestChainedPromises (async-callstack-async-await2.html:66) | |
13 3) testFunctionTimeout (async-callstack-async-await2.html:50) | |
14 [setTimeout] | 10 [setTimeout] |
15 0) testFunction (async-callstack-async-await2.html:43) | 11 0) testFunction (async-callstack-async-await2.html:43) |
16 [setTimeout] | 12 [setTimeout] |
17 0) scheduleTestFunction (debugger-test.js:3) | 13 0) scheduleTestFunction (debugger-test.js:3) |
18 <... skipped remaining frames ...> | 14 <... skipped remaining frames ...> |
19 | 15 |
20 Call stack: | 16 Call stack: |
21 0) doTestChainedPromises (async-callstack-async-await2.html:69) | 17 0) doTestChainedPromises (async-callstack-async-await2.html:69) |
22 [Promise.resolve] | 18 [async function] |
23 0) resolvePromise (async-callstack-async-await2.html:12) | 19 0) doTestChainedPromises (async-callstack-async-await2.html:63) |
24 [setTimeout] | 20 1) testFunctionTimeout (async-callstack-async-await2.html:50) |
25 0) promiseCallback (async-callstack-async-await2.html:21) | |
26 1) timeoutPromise (async-callstack-async-await2.html:9) | |
27 2) doTestChainedPromises (async-callstack-async-await2.html:68) | |
28 [Promise.resolve] | |
29 0) resolvePromise (async-callstack-async-await2.html:12) | |
30 [setTimeout] | |
31 0) promiseCallback (async-callstack-async-await2.html:21) | |
32 1) timeoutPromise (async-callstack-async-await2.html:9) | |
33 2) doTestChainedPromises (async-callstack-async-await2.html:66) | |
34 3) testFunctionTimeout (async-callstack-async-await2.html:50) | |
35 [setTimeout] | 21 [setTimeout] |
36 0) testFunction (async-callstack-async-await2.html:43) | 22 0) testFunction (async-callstack-async-await2.html:43) |
| 23 [setTimeout] |
| 24 0) scheduleTestFunction (debugger-test.js:3) |
| 25 <... skipped remaining frames ...> |
37 | 26 |
38 Call stack: | 27 Call stack: |
39 0) doTestChainedPromises (async-callstack-async-await2.html:71) | 28 0) doTestChainedPromises (async-callstack-async-await2.html:71) |
40 [Promise.resolve] | 29 [async function] |
41 0) doTestChainedPromises (async-callstack-async-await2.html:70) | 30 0) doTestChainedPromises (async-callstack-async-await2.html:63) |
42 [Promise.resolve] | 31 1) testFunctionTimeout (async-callstack-async-await2.html:50) |
43 0) resolvePromise (async-callstack-async-await2.html:12) | |
44 [setTimeout] | 32 [setTimeout] |
45 0) promiseCallback (async-callstack-async-await2.html:21) | 33 0) testFunction (async-callstack-async-await2.html:43) |
46 1) timeoutPromise (async-callstack-async-await2.html:9) | |
47 2) doTestChainedPromises (async-callstack-async-await2.html:68) | |
48 [Promise.resolve] | |
49 0) resolvePromise (async-callstack-async-await2.html:12) | |
50 [setTimeout] | 34 [setTimeout] |
51 0) promiseCallback (async-callstack-async-await2.html:21) | 35 0) scheduleTestFunction (debugger-test.js:3) |
52 1) timeoutPromise (async-callstack-async-await2.html:9) | 36 <... skipped remaining frames ...> |
53 2) doTestChainedPromises (async-callstack-async-await2.html:66) | |
54 3) testFunctionTimeout (async-callstack-async-await2.html:50) | |
55 | 37 |
56 Call stack: | 38 Call stack: |
57 0) doTestChainedPromises (async-callstack-async-await2.html:73) | 39 0) doTestChainedPromises (async-callstack-async-await2.html:73) |
58 [Promise.resolve] | 40 [async function] |
59 0) doTestChainedPromises (async-callstack-async-await2.html:72) | 41 0) doTestChainedPromises (async-callstack-async-await2.html:63) |
60 [Promise.resolve] | 42 1) testFunctionTimeout (async-callstack-async-await2.html:50) |
61 0) doTestChainedPromises (async-callstack-async-await2.html:70) | |
62 [Promise.resolve] | |
63 0) resolvePromise (async-callstack-async-await2.html:12) | |
64 [setTimeout] | 43 [setTimeout] |
65 0) promiseCallback (async-callstack-async-await2.html:21) | 44 0) testFunction (async-callstack-async-await2.html:43) |
66 1) timeoutPromise (async-callstack-async-await2.html:9) | 45 [setTimeout] |
67 2) doTestChainedPromises (async-callstack-async-await2.html:68) | 46 0) scheduleTestFunction (debugger-test.js:3) |
68 [Promise.resolve] | 47 <... skipped remaining frames ...> |
69 0) resolvePromise (async-callstack-async-await2.html:12) | |
70 | 48 |
71 Call stack: | 49 Call stack: |
72 0) thenCallback (async-callstack-async-await2.html:55) | 50 0) thenCallback (async-callstack-async-await2.html:55) |
73 1) doTestChainedPromises (async-callstack-async-await2.html:74) | 51 1) doTestChainedPromises (async-callstack-async-await2.html:74) |
74 [Promise.resolve] | 52 [async function] |
75 0) resolvePromise (async-callstack-async-await2.html:12) | 53 0) doTestChainedPromises (async-callstack-async-await2.html:63) |
| 54 1) testFunctionTimeout (async-callstack-async-await2.html:50) |
76 [setTimeout] | 55 [setTimeout] |
77 0) promiseCallback (async-callstack-async-await2.html:21) | 56 0) testFunction (async-callstack-async-await2.html:43) |
78 1) timeoutPromise (async-callstack-async-await2.html:9) | 57 [setTimeout] |
79 2) doTestChainedPromises (async-callstack-async-await2.html:74) | 58 0) scheduleTestFunction (debugger-test.js:3) |
80 [Promise.resolve] | 59 <... skipped remaining frames ...> |
81 0) doTestChainedPromises (async-callstack-async-await2.html:72) | |
82 [Promise.resolve] | |
83 0) doTestChainedPromises (async-callstack-async-await2.html:70) | |
84 [Promise.resolve] | |
85 0) resolvePromise (async-callstack-async-await2.html:12) | |
86 | 60 |
87 Call stack: | 61 Call stack: |
88 0) thenCallback (async-callstack-async-await2.html:55) | 62 0) thenCallback (async-callstack-async-await2.html:55) |
89 1) doTestChainedPromisesJSON (async-callstack-async-await2.html:86) | 63 1) doTestChainedPromisesJSON (async-callstack-async-await2.html:86) |
90 [Promise.resolve] | 64 [async function] |
91 0) doTestChainedPromisesJSON (async-callstack-async-await2.html:85) | 65 0) doTestChainedPromisesJSON (async-callstack-async-await2.html:80) |
92 [Promise.resolve] | 66 1) testFunctionTimeout (async-callstack-async-await2.html:50) |
93 0) doTestChainedPromisesJSON (async-callstack-async-await2.html:84) | |
94 [Promise.resolve] | |
95 0) resolvePromise (async-callstack-async-await2.html:12) | |
96 [setTimeout] | |
97 0) promiseCallback (async-callstack-async-await2.html:21) | |
98 1) timeoutPromise (async-callstack-async-await2.html:9) | |
99 2) doTestChainedPromisesJSON (async-callstack-async-await2.html:83) | |
100 3) testFunctionTimeout (async-callstack-async-await2.html:50) | |
101 [setTimeout] | 67 [setTimeout] |
102 0) testFunction (async-callstack-async-await2.html:43) | 68 0) testFunction (async-callstack-async-await2.html:43) |
| 69 [setTimeout] |
| 70 0) scheduleTestFunction (debugger-test.js:3) |
| 71 <... skipped remaining frames ...> |
103 | 72 |
104 | 73 |
OLD | NEW |